Output 17fb4e75c1db27b36c2bfc6e2d4afef5277ffd41e786ca99528a095a09875f94:1

value
102229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6022ec27cca7154289a065b47eb2c0cfa5c7201 OP_EQUAL
address
3MCb9FPtrzRBofXrjqvMwU4ooHEBoAchbr
transaction
17fb4e75c1db27b36c2bfc6e2d4afef5277ffd41e786ca99528a095a09875f94
confirmations
374823
spent
true